#純靠北工程師47w
----------
有時候新人看公司舊專案會覺得這種寫法很白癡,db schema怎麼會這樣設計,這樣這樣寫不是會乾淨很多嗎?
那是因為他們不知道這個專案是在早上說要A,下午說要B,明天說要C,上線前說要改回A的情況下寫出來的。這樣寫法不好大家都知道,但上面說馬上要你怎麼辦,就硬改啊,反正沒壞就好,或者是不要在我手上壞就好
----------
🗳️ [群眾審核] https://kaobei.engineer/cards/review
👉 [GitHub Repo] https://github.com/init-engineer/init.engineer
📢 [匿名發文] https://kaobei.engineer/cards/create
🥙 [全平台留言] https://kaobei.engineer/cards/show/5468
「db schema設計」的推薦目錄:
- 關於db schema設計 在 純靠北工程師 Facebook 的最佳貼文
- 關於db schema設計 在 軟體開發學習資訊分享 Facebook 的最佳解答
- 關於db schema設計 在 [問題] 關於聊天室schema設計- 看板Programming - 批踢踢實業坊 的評價
- 關於db schema設計 在 [架構設計] 高性能DB 架構設計(RDBMS / NoSQL / Cache) 的評價
- 關於db schema設計 在 database.md - 資料庫 的評價
- 關於db schema設計 在 軟體開發學習資訊分享- 各種關聯資料庫的Schema 設計... 的評價
- 關於db schema設計 在 系统设计系列讲解42 Design Twitter - Database Schema与REST 的評價
- 關於db schema設計 在 db schema設計的問題包括PTT、Dcard、Mobile01,我們都能 ... 的評價
- 關於db schema設計 在 db schema設計的問題包括PTT、Dcard、Mobile01,我們都能 ... 的評價
- 關於db schema設計 在 db schema設計的問題包括PTT、Dcard、Mobile01,我們都能 ... 的評價
db schema設計 在 [架構設計] 高性能DB 架構設計(RDBMS / NoSQL / Cache) 的推薦與評價
此篇文章是極客時間"從0 開始學架構"課程時所留下的學習筆記,主要內容為高性能DB 架構設計,包含了RDBMS、NoSQL & Cache 的架構設計考量& 運用方式. ... <看更多>
db schema設計 在 database.md - 資料庫 的推薦與評價
通常不會讓終端使用者可以動態新建table 和修改schema。database schema 比較像是你程式的一部分,你的source code 會依賴於schema 設計。另外也有效能的考量,變更schema ... ... <看更多>
db schema設計 在 [問題] 關於聊天室schema設計- 看板Programming - 批踢踢實業坊 的推薦與評價
請問一下各位大大, 假設我要做一個聊天室, 包含團隊頻道和個人頻道
db schema 大致為
好友table
uid
fid
time
使用者table
userid
time
聊天table
sid
type(1:團隊 2:個人(私聊))
rid(房間id)
msg(裡面會包含訊息與發送者資訊)
time
如果是團隊部分rid, 就是user所加入的團隊id, 比較單純
但如果個人部分的rid
我的想法是A_B的userid做為rid
例如玩家A userid : 100001, 玩家B userid : 100002
rid = 100001_100002(小的編號放置在前面)
但這樣查詢有點麻煩, 如果我要查詢目前我的私聊有哪些新訊息
我必須
1. 拉出我的好友名單
2. 將我的userid與好友userid組成rid, 還需判斷小的編號要放前面
3. 將組好的rid, 丟到聊天table查詢
感覺有點複雜, 不知道大家有沒有比較好的設計?
--
※ 發信站: 批踢踢實業坊(ptt.cc), 來自: 114.34.181.227
※ 文章網址: https://www.ptt.cc/bbs/Programming/M.1485006869.A.389.html
... <看更多>